Lazio thought they’d won it with a controversial penalty when completing the comeback, but Ricky Saponara’s astonishing flick rescued a Sampdoria point.

It was an extraordinary 2-2 draw at the Stadio Olimpico, the Aquile’s fourth consecutive stalemate.

Fabio Quagliarella had opened the scoring by meeting a Nicola Murru low cross at the back post, but the hosts equalised after a long fightback through Francesco Acerbi.

Immobile converted a penalty awarded for a dubious Joachim Andersen handling offence at the 96th minute and seemed to have won the game.

However, substitute Saponara had another twist in the tale with an acrobatic, Zlatan Ibrahimovic-esque mid-air flick to float the ball over Thomas Strakosha and equalise at the 99th minute.
